自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(17)
  • 收藏
  • 关注

原创 LVS-nat模式http+mysql和端口修改

首先要准备四台虚拟机两台RIP一台VIP一台客户端RIP的网关一定要指定到VIP同网段地址上然后就是在rip上安装httpd然后更改网址首页为RS1 server 192.168.26.100RS2 server 192.168.26.101两台都要安装和更改VIP机器上,需要安装ipvsadm ,然后地址是RIP设置的网关,还要同网段然后再加一个网卡和客户端同一网段客户端网段和新添加网卡 网段为172.16.1.0/24安装完ipvsadm之后,我们就可以添加机器了ipvsadm

2021-02-28 21:41:59 351

原创 nginx-负载均衡

众所周知,nginx负载均衡分为三种(轮询,调度,ip_hash)今天就演示这三种配置为了更好的体验功能的实用性,我在第二台虚拟机上添加了,相同ip不同端口号的虚拟主机轮询其次,在第一台机器上打开主配置文件vim /usr/local/nginx/conf/nginx.conf然后在server的上面添加 upstream backend { server 192.168.26.101:80; server 192.168.26.101:81 ;}然后下面

2021-02-23 10:58:11 148

原创 nginx-反向代理

首先要吧nginx装好其次打开主配置文件 vim /usr/local/nginx/conf/nginx.conf然后在server里添加locationlocation / { proxy_pass http://www.baidu.com; }记住上面那个默认location一定要删除,要不然访问的时候,会显示默认网站首页删除完之后,保存退出,然后在进行重载一下就成功了/usr/local/nginx/sbin/nginx -s

2021-02-23 09:31:39 176

原创 LAMP-别名目录访问-用户认证-无首页访问暴露目录以及补救措施

首先基础配置都是要安装的刚安装的时候,可以在/var/www/html/下写一个index.php文件内容为<?php phpinfo(); ?>可以测试apache是否支持php,然后重启服务访问的话就是http://192.168.26.100/index.php这个格式了好了,下面就开始做别名访问了首先,先创建一个目录mkdir /usr/local/phpdata然后进入目录里面写一个html的文件然后保存退出,在进行下一步这时候进入主配之文件也就是vim /e

2021-02-21 23:35:54 190

原创 DAID-10

1

2021-02-21 15:52:12 192

原创 RAID-5

今天做一个raid5当然也是软raid然后扩展硬盘的做法首先硬盘添加是要够的然后使用mdadm这个命令mdadm -C -v /dev/md5 -l 5 -n 3 -x 1 -c 32 /dev/sd[g,h,i,j]前面的我就不说了吧,这个-c是chunk设定阵列的块chunk块大小,单位为kb然后查看下这个磁盘[root@localhost ~]# mdadm -D /dev/md5 /dev/md5: Version : 1.2 Creation Ti

2021-02-21 14:53:54 132

原创 RAID之raid-1镜像卷

这次做的是raid1然后模拟其中一个盘故障,然后看看我们添加的备用盘会不会给给替补上去首先还是mdadm命令 mdadm -C -v /dev/md1 -l 1 -n 2 -x 1 /dev/sd[d,e,f] -C 是创建 -v 显示过程 -l 级别为1 -n是数量为2 -x 是备用盘为1 [root@localhost ~]# mdadm -C -v /dev/md1 -l 1 -n 2 -x 1 /dev/sd[d,e,f]mdadm: Note: this array has meta

2021-02-20 23:21:40 1088

原创 raid之创建磁盘列阵raid-0

1首先关闭虚拟机多添加几个20G的磁盘,如果想做多个实验的话,就多添加几个我这里做的是raid 0算是一个基础吧添加完之后使用命令查看磁盘信息,确保数量够用然后就开始输入mdadm -C -v /dev/md0 -l 0 -n 2 /dev/sd[b,c]这里我用sdb和sdc来做raid0 -C是创建 -l是指定级别 -n 是指定数量 然后指定要组成的磁盘 -v显示详细信息这个时候有这个提示就说明创建成功[root@localhost ~]# mdadm -C -v /dev/md0

2021-02-20 21:58:48 1125

原创 docker之扫雷小游戏

1,首先要准备扫雷这个压缩包2,其次要吧这个压缩包给拖到Linux里面,放到与dockerfile文件同一个目录编辑文件,文件名必须是dockerfile(原因可以去网上找)进去之后需要指定要用镜像FROM centos:7 (没有镜像可以pull一个)然后去阿里云官网上,找base源和epel源记得要用curl -o 这样方式来下载RUN curl -o /etc/yum.repos.d/CentOS-Base.repo https://mirrors.aliyun.com/repo/Ce

2021-02-05 17:07:50 895

原创 mariadb之异步同步

今天来写一个mariadb的异步同步5.5.65版本的1 首先安装mariadb用yum安装yum -y install mariadb*2 安装完成之后先别启动编辑配置文件 vim/etc/my.cnf.d/server.cnf然后在server下输入server_id=1log_bin=log-bin保存退出之后在启动mariadb这个服务systemctl start mariadb.service启动完成之后,使用firewall 允许mysql这个服务进出firewa

2021-01-28 22:40:06 182

原创 mariadb之半同步

今天做一个mariadb的半同步实验首先这个实验是基于异步同步来做的,需要吧异步同步给做完才能做半同步首先我们要在数据库里安装两个插件install plugin rpl_semi_sync_master soname 'semisync_master.so';install plugin rpl_semi_sync_slave soname 'semisync_slave.so';这两个插件在主库和从库都要安装必须要安装然后在主库上,编辑配置文件vim /etc/my.cnf.d/se

2021-01-27 17:32:48 268

原创 zabbix之钉钉

今天来写一个zabbix的钉钉报警首先你要创建一个钉钉群,在钉钉群里添加一个机器人,点击机器人,点击机器人设置,找到wehook即可(先不要复制)做完以上步骤就可以开始以下教程了(下面行为均为主控端执行)1 进入/usr/lib/zabbix/alertscripts下(这里是默认定义脚本的目录)编写一个python脚本,后缀为.py为结尾的脚本文件代码为#!/usr/bin/env python#coding:utf-8#zabbix钉钉报警import requests,json,s

2021-01-03 20:33:03 920

原创 zabbix-磁盘报警

今天来写一个zabbix监控磁盘报警题材安装zabbix和创建磁盘监控项这些就不说了直接进入主题1 首先我是5.0版本在左下角倒数第二个,点进去,吧报警和发消息给打开2 在配置-主机里添加触发器这里监控项选的是之前我做的一个监控磁盘的这里完成之后,原磁盘是没有那么大空间的,为此我们就可以使用dd这个命令dd if=/dev/zero of=a.txt count=200 bs=50M当我们添加到一定程度,大于你设置的阈值,打开web界面的时候,就会发出警告...

2021-01-02 20:56:13 601 1

原创 2021-01-02

监控nginx首先在受控端上安装nginx这个就不说了吧直接跳转关键部分~1 安装完nginx之后在nginx主配置文件里的server下写入location /nginx_status { stub_status on; access_log off; allow 192.168.1.0/24;保存并退出,然后重载nginx服务,然后去访问在/etc/zabbix/zabbix.agend.d/下写nginx脚本格式为she

2021-01-02 19:38:44 120

原创 zabbix-监控磁盘

监控磁盘1 在受控主机上/cd /etc/zabbix/zabbix_agentd.d/下写入配置文件2 在文件内写入UserParameter=iotps,iostat | awk ‘/^sda/{print $2}’然后保存退出3 写完之后我们要查看下磁盘的运行状况 这里是需要安装的要不然是用不了命令查看yum -y install sysstat 安装完成之后,可以用iostat查看(当然这这个步骤不是测试,只是查看磁盘状况)4 写完配置文件之后可以在受控主机上查看下 使用

2021-01-02 19:11:36 667

原创 nginx-之动静分离

centos7上使用nginx实现动静分离由于环境问题,我就准备了两台centos7 一台来当访问静态页面的,一台为访问动态页面的首先我们要确保nginx的正常访问以及两台centos7的通信(两台都需要安装nginx)1 首先我们打开nginx’的主配置文件进行编辑在server下写入location ~ .(gif|jpg|js|html)$ {root /mnt/;}location ~ .(jps|php)$ {proxy_pass http://192.168.1.66;}完

2020-12-29 18:02:36 172

原创 安装docker

我本人用的华为的镜像源,如果你们想用其他源也是可以的1 第一步更新base源 wget -O /etc/yum.repos.d/CentOS-Base.repo https://mirrors.huaweicloud.com/repository/conf/CentOS-7-anon.repo2 第二步,在华为源里面找到docker-ce这个选项3 点进去之后选择第二个选项(本人用的centOS系统)4 下载epel扩展包 wget -O /e

2020-12-11 20:48:18 508

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除